4

ニュースフィードを取得する API は次のとおりです: https://graph.facebook.com/me/home?access_token= &limit=1000&until=

これは、前のフィードを取得するための「次の」URL を含むページ分割されたフィード出力を返します。

ただし、一定時間を超えるとニュースフィードが返されなくなります。したがって、数日のニュースフィードは解析にのみ使用できます。

Facebook API を使用して、より歴史的なニュースフィードを取得する方法はありますか?

4

1 に答える 1

4

グラフ API ドキュメント ページを見ると、/me/home履歴は 1 ~ 2 週間に限定されており、「これについては気にしない」カテゴリに分類されています。

/me/homeニュース フィードの古いビューを取得します。これは現在既知の問題であり、それらを同等に戻すための当面の計画はありません。

/me/feed代わりに使用してください。

sinceパラメータとパラメータを使用してuntil、ユーザーのフィードから履歴データを取得できます。これにより、2012 年 8 月 15 ~ 20 日に表示された投稿が表示されます。

/me/feed?since=2012-08-15&until=2012-08-20

によって返されるデータ/me/feed/も制限されます。制限は明示されていませんが、1 回の API 呼び出しで 30 日を超える投稿にアクセスできるとは思っていません。

于 2012-10-03T18:01:58.953 に答える